Lushnjë weather in May

In May, Lushnjë sees average daytime highs of 24°C and overnight lows near 14°C, with 63 mm of rain across 9.1 wet days and about 14.3 hours of daylight. It is the 5th-warmest and 9th-wettest month of the year here.

Highs climb over the month, from about 23°C in the first days to 26°C by the end.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 49% of the time in May, and the air most often feels dry.

Daylight stretches from about 13 h 42 min at the start of May to 14 h 42 min by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, May is Lushnjë's 6th-clearest and 8th-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Lushnjë's year-round climate.

Highs climb over the month, from about 23°C in the first days to 26°C by the end.

A typical May day in Lushnjë reaches about 24°C in the afternoon and slips back to 14°C overnight — a 10°C spread between the day's warmth and the night's chill. On most days the high lands between 20°C and 28°C. Set against its neighbours, May runs about 4°C warmer than April and about 4°C cooler than June.

Sea temperature near Lushnjë in May

The nearest coast averages about 19°C in May — the other half of the beach question. The full-year curve and swim-comfort zones are below.

The sea at the nearest coast (about 29 km away) is warmest in August at about 25°C and coldest in February near 14°C.

It's comfortable for a long swim from May 27 to Nov 6 — about 5.4 months when the water holds above 20°C.

Location & terrain

Where is Lushnjë?

Lushnjë sits at 40.9°N, 19.7°E, 22 m above sea level, in Albania. The nearest listed city is Peqin, 12 km away.

Topography around Lushnjë

How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Lushnjë.

Within 3 km, the terrain around Lushnjë has signific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 251 m around an average of 51 m above sea level; within 16 km, signific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 486 m; within 80 km, very signific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 2,377 m.

The land around Lushnjë is covered by grassland (34%), trees (25%) and cropland (21%) within 3 km, cropland (39%), grassland (30%) and trees (21%) within 16 km, and trees (40%), grassland (25%) and water (25%) within 80 km.
